Relaxation. A Photography and Poetry Prompt

As I said on last week’s poetry prompt, I am going to find the next few,  in the backlog of poems I have outstanding, rather tricky – and this one is no exception. What I did know is that I wanted to start and end with the title word of the poem and I worked around it from there.

I generally seem to find the photos fairly easy and straightforward. This week’s image is of Ross taking it easy as he did a warm up song with his band, D-State, last Saturday at a family fun evening! Now that is what I call relaxation! 

Relaxation

Relaxation is a thing
when all is said and done
The thing that stops you stressing out
Take care of number one

Things they may be bothersome
and get right on your nerves
Stop for just a moment
Give your body what it deserves

Take time and take care
Of you and how you feel
You only get just one life
Take time out to heal

Then once you have recuperated
After lots of cogitation
You can take on life again
Thanks to that relaxation

Victoria Welton 2nd September 2015
